## Deployment

InkSlab renders PDF invoices for the Tallowmere billing stack. Build the container, push to the internal registry, roll via the standard pipeline. One replica per region is enough; rendering is CPU-bound, not memory-bound. Health checks hit the render probe endpoint every ten seconds. Do not deploy during invoice batch windows. Before the first rollout, set the following configuration values in the service environment.

service settings:
[ulair]
team = praath
access_code = ac_06d704
owner = wenix.ulair
host = ulair.qirvancorp.corp
port = 9200
peer = sorys.nelvronet.internal
salt = 2668132c
pin = 9140

Runbook 4.2 — Seed sample transfer. Samples: Eastvale trial plot, Greymoor cultivars, three sealed crates. Temperature band 8–14°C; log at pickup and drop. Route via Tarnbeck bypass only. Driver signs the custody sheet at both ends. No stops, no co-loads. Give the courier the following instruction at hand-over.

dispatch memo: the eliok quenok courier leaves the sorael aldath belion tammir casix gileth queniel jorath ledger at gate 9299 under passcode 897989

## SpoolKit won't pick up queued jobs

If SpoolKit sits idle while jobs pile up, it's almost always a stuck lease in the Fennwright queue. First check the lease table — anything older than ten minutes is dead. Clear it with the reaper command, then restart the worker pod. Jobs should drain within a minute.

If the queue API rejects the reaper call, your credential expired. For staging, authenticate with the token below.

login token, bagug-kafop: eyJhbGciOiJIUzI1NiIsInR5cCI6IkpXVCJ9.eyJzdWIiOiIcMLov2In0.Z5RLDIfp

### Read-replica lag alarm

If the Fernbrook lag alarm fires, don't panic — it's usually a long analytics query hogging the replica. Check the query log first, kill anything over five minutes, and watch lag drain. If it doesn't recover in ten minutes, hit the Copperline failover endpoint, which requires the service key. Here it is for staging.

gateway credential: kto3_qfe